The Physical Surveillance Detection Method
Physical surveillance detection involves observing your surroundings for signs of monitoring. This can include watching for suspicious individuals, taking note of unfamiliar vehicles or license plates, and using mirrors or binoculars to survey your environment.
The Electronic Surveillance Detection Method
Electronic surveillance detection involves identifying potential electronic monitoring devices, such as hidden cameras, microphones, or GPS trackers. This can be achieved through the use of specialized equipment, such as spectrum analyzers or signal detectors.
